See starvation has nothing to do with bounded waiting. In above example if there are infinite number of high priority process coming so there is no bound on number of process hence bounded waiting is not satisfied. So bounded waiting is related to number of processes. Starvation is long waiting which is related to time, if for a long time process does not get to enter the CS then there is starvation for sure. But main question is does progress + bounded waiting -> starvation free Yes, because there is bound on number of process that can enter before one particular process, and since there is progress one process will not prevent other process to get into CS. Now let's see one example where starvation is there but bounded waiting is satisfied If one process is stuck in a loop inside CS it will not let other process come in so starvation is there. But we are sure that if that process comes out of CS then other process will get in so there is a bound on number of process so bounded waiting is satisfied here. So bounded waiting -> starvation freedom Or starvation freedom -> bounded waiting Both are false statements. 0 votes 0 votes Subbu. commented Jan 29, 2022 reply Follow Share Then if Process is in infinite loop,,there is a possibility of progress ...
